Bis(2,2,6,6-tetramethylpiperidin-4-yl) decanedioate

Q. Zhou, W.-Y. Wu, X.-S. Gao, C. Yao and J.-T. Wang

Abstract: The asymmetric unit of the title compound, C28H52N2O4, contains one half-molecule; the molecule is located on a centre of inversion. The piperidine ring has a distorted chair conformation. In the crystal structure, intermolecular N-H...O hydrogen bonds link the molecules, forming a network, which may be effective in the stabilization of the crystal structure.
